How It Works

How HRA Exemption Is Calculated

House Rent Allowance (HRA) is a salary component that reduces your taxable income if you pay rent. Under Section 10(13A) of the Income Tax Act, the exempt portion of HRA is the minimum of three amounts.

HRA exemption = lowest of:
1. Actual HRA received from employer
2. 50% of (Basic + DA) for metro  |  40% for non-metro
3. Actual rent paid − 10% of (Basic + DA)

Whichever of these three is smallest becomes your tax-free HRA. The remaining HRA is added to taxable salary. This is exactly what the calculator above computes in real time.

Metro vs Non-Metro Cities

Only four cities count as metro for HRA: Delhi, Mumbai, Kolkata and Chennai. Everywhere else, including Noida, Gurugram, Bengaluru, Hyderabad and Pune, is non-metro. This single classification changes condition 2 from 50% to 40% and can significantly change your exemption.

Worked Example: Delhi Employee

Basic + DA: Rs 30,000/month. HRA received: Rs 15,000. Rent paid: Rs 18,000. City: Delhi (metro).

Condition 1: Rs 15,000. Condition 2: 50% of 30,000 = Rs 15,000. Condition 3: 18,000 − 3,000 = Rs 15,000. The exempt amount is the lowest, here Rs 15,000 if all equal, or whichever is smallest when figures differ. The calculator handles every combination automatically.

Documents You Need to Claim HRA

To claim HRA exemption while the employer computes TDS, keep rent receipts for every month. If annual rent exceeds Rs 1,00,000, the landlord PAN is mandatory. A clean salary structure on your salary slip format makes the Basic + DA figure unambiguous, which is the base for two of the three conditions.

HRA in the Old vs New Tax Regime

HRA exemption exists only in the old tax regime. If you opt for the new regime, the entire HRA is taxable, though the new regime offers lower slab rates. Employees who pay significant rent should compare both before declaring their regime. Frequently Asked

HRA Calculator FAQs

How is HRA exemption calculated in India?
HRA exemption under Section 10(13A) is the minimum of three: actual HRA received, 50% of Basic+DA (metro) or 40% (non-metro), and rent paid minus 10% of Basic+DA. The lowest is exempt; the rest is taxable.
Which cities are metro for HRA calculation?
Only Delhi, Mumbai, Kolkata and Chennai are metro (50%). All others including Noida, Gurugram, Bengaluru, Hyderabad and Pune are non-metro (40%).
Is HRA exemption available in the new tax regime?
No. HRA exemption applies only in the old tax regime. Under the new regime, HRA received is fully taxable.
Can I claim HRA if I live in my own house?
No. HRA exemption requires that you actually pay rent for a house you occupy and do not own. No rent paid means the full HRA is taxable.
Do I need rent receipts and landlord PAN?
Rent receipts are required. If annual rent exceeds Rs 1,00,000, the landlord PAN must also be submitted to the employer for the exemption during TDS computation.
Can I claim both HRA and a home loan deduction?
Yes, in genuine cases. HRA for a rented house you live in and a home loan deduction for a property you own elsewhere can both be claimed if real and documented.
How much HRA is tax-free for Delhi NCR employees?
Delhi is metro, so up to 50% of Basic+DA can qualify, subject to the other two conditions. Noida and Gurugram are non-metro at 40%. Use the calculator for an exact figure.
